The French Recreational Boating License Adopts a New Format

It was unveiled by Fabrice Loher, Minister Delegate for Maritime Affairs and Fisheries, at the Grand Pavois nautical festival: the new format of the Boating License has been in effect since October 3, 2024. In this article, the Bateau-immatriculation.com team presents it to you.

It is often referred to as the "Pleasure Boat License". Officially, it is called the Motor Pleasure Boat Driving License or Personal Watercraft Driving License. Issued nearly 100,000 times each year by the French Ministry of Transport, it allows boaters to operate motor pleasure boats with an engine power greater than 6 fiscal horsepower, or 4.5 kilowatts.

A new boat license to modernize recreational boating

Until early October 2024, the Inland or Sea Boat License - whether coastal or offshore - was issued in paper format. It was a three-part document, representing a vertical rectangle of 100 mm by 70 mm when folded.

Since the end of 2024, the Boat License has been presented on a new, more compact, more resistant, and more durable support, still rectangular – this time, horizontally oriented, in "credit card" format.

Now measuring 85.6 mm by 53.98 mm and made of plastic, the Boat License joins the secure documents and titles produced by France Titres and the Imprimerie Nationale – or IN Groupe.

Why this change?

The switch to the new format of the boating license is an integral part of a broader modernization initiative for recreational boating procedures, led by the Minister Delegate for Maritime Affairs and Fisheries and the Directorate General for Maritime Affairs, Fisheries and Aquaculture – or DGAMPA.

A reliable boating license that includes all the information

Like the Type B driver's license or the latest generation national identity card, the new version of the boat license features several pieces of information and elements on a secure background on both sides.

The boat license in its new format

On the front:

  • The mentions "Pleasure boat license" and "French Republic"
  • The logo of the French Republic
  • The name of the license holder
  • The first name(s)
  • The date of birth
  • The place of birth
  • The date of issue of the license
  • The medical code
  • The license number
  • The title number
  • A QR code to access the digital data associated with the title
  • A photograph of the holder, protected by an optically variable device
  • A Multiple Laser Image including the holder's portrait and the title number.

 

On the back:

  • Details of the options and extensions, or prerogatives, possibly held by the title holder: Coastal option, Offshore extension, Inland waters option and/or Large pleasure craft inland waters extension
  • The effective dates of the options and extensions
  • The issuing authorities
  • A secure code containing the portrait image.

A secure recreational boating license

For added security, in addition to specific security markings on the document, the 2024 Pleasure Boat License also features invisible fluorescent inks, visible under ultraviolet light.

Please note: while the medium changes, the new format of the Pleasure Boat License does not alter the conditions for issuing the document. The pleasure boat license reform of June 1, 2022, is still in effect, and all recreational boaters wishing to operate a pleasure craft with an engine power greater than 4.5 kilowatts or 6 fiscal horsepower are still required to hold the document!

A theoretical exam, a practical exam, and the purchase of a 78-euro fiscal stamp are still necessary to obtain the 2024 boat license. Finally, like the old document, the new French boat license does not have an expiration date.

A new international boat license

Always with the aim of simplifying procedures for recreational boaters, the Ministry Delegate for Maritime Affairs and Fisheries, the DGAMPA, and France Titres have designed a new boat license that also allows for **hassle-free navigation abroad**.

The Pleasure Boat License for Motorboats was already valid internationally before October 3, 2024. However, until then, boaters planning to navigate internationally were responsible for obtaining an official translation of their boat license, to be presented in case of inspection by authorities in the desired country of navigation.

The **QR code** on the new boat license aims, in particular, to facilitate the boater's use of the license abroad and the conduct of at-sea inspections if necessary: it now allows authorities to access the **license data in digital format**, **translated into most foreign languages**. Information, including privileges and any medical restrictions, is thus directly accessible.

Getting a boating license in its new format

Since the new boat license came into force on October 3, 2024, the new version of the document is issued to every new holder.

But don't worry: if you have a pleasure craft license in an older format, you do not need to apply for a renewal. Your sea license or river license naturally remains valid, without any need for special procedures!

However, if you wish to exchange a paper boat license for a card-format boat license, it is possible: if you hold an old license and apply for a duplicate Pleasure Craft License, or an extension, then your license will be renewed and you will obtain the new Motor Pleasure Craft Driving License.
